Skip to content

Add AI policy to contribution guidelines and PR template#12909

Merged
TobiGr merged 1 commit intodevfrom
no-ai
Dec 25, 2025
Merged

Add AI policy to contribution guidelines and PR template#12909
TobiGr merged 1 commit intodevfrom
no-ai

Conversation

@TobiGr
Copy link
Copy Markdown
Contributor

@TobiGr TobiGr commented Dec 15, 2025

What is it?

  • Bugfix (user facing)
  • Feature (user facing) ⚠️ Your PR must target the refactor branch
  • Codebase improvement (dev facing)
  • Meta improvement to the project (dev facing)

Description of the changes in your PR

This adds an AI policy to the contribution guidelines and new checks to the PR template. The amount of AI generated PRs is increasing while their quality is often not sufficient.

To do

  • squash commits

Due diligence

@TobiGr TobiGr added the meta Related to the project but not strictly to code label Dec 15, 2025
@github-actions github-actions Bot added the size/small PRs with less than 50 changed lines label Dec 15, 2025
Comment thread .github/PULL_REQUEST_TEMPLATE.md Outdated
Comment thread .github/CONTRIBUTING.md Outdated
@TobiGr TobiGr force-pushed the no-ai branch 3 times, most recently from 7d1a348 to c408135 Compare December 16, 2025 13:29
Copy link
Copy Markdown
Member

@theimpulson theimpulson left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Minor typo. Looks good to me otherwise.

Comment thread .github/CONTRIBUTING.md Outdated
Comment thread .github/CONTRIBUTING.md Outdated
The amount of AI generated PRs is increasing while their quality often remains poor. The introduced guidelines aim to reduce the number of poor quality AI PRs while simultaneously increasing the quality of high quality AI PRs.

New checkboxes for compliance with the AI policy and to increase the PR quality are introduced to the PR template.

Prohibit AI generated issue and PR descriptions
Copy link
Copy Markdown
Member

@theimpulson theimpulson left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Looks good to me

@TobiGr TobiGr merged commit 350d08b into dev Dec 25, 2025
1 check passed
@TobiGr TobiGr deleted the no-ai branch December 25, 2025 09:31
@TobiGr TobiGr mentioned this pull request Dec 27, 2025
4 tasks
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

meta Related to the project but not strictly to code size/small PRs with less than 50 changed lines

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ants